Fit and Sizing
My buying decision would depend heavily on fit. I would make sure the shoe matches my foot shape well, especially around the toe box and midfoot. If I have wider feet, I would check whether the width options suit me. A proper fit is important to me because even a great shoe can feel disappointing if it rubs or feels too tight.
Support and Ride Feel
I like shoes that feel stable but still natural, and that is what I would expect from the Ride 17 Women’s. My focus would be on whether it gives me enough support for neutral running without making the shoe feel stiff. I would choose it if I wanted a balanced ride that works well for daily miles.
Breathability and Upper Material
Since I often run in different weather conditions, I always check the upper material. I would look for a breathable mesh that helps keep my feet cooler and more comfortable. For me, a well-ventilated upper is a big advantage because it reduces overheating during longer sessions.
Durability for Daily Use
I want my running shoes to last, especially if I use them often. I would consider the outsole durability and overall build quality before buying. If I plan to use the Saucony Ride 17 Women’s as my main trainer, I would want confidence that it can handle regular mileage without wearing out too quickly.
